Rising Tensions Drive Expansion

Taiwanese lenders operating in Hong kong are strategically ⁢expanding their presence,capitalizing on ⁢opportunities created by increasing geopolitical tensions. this move contrasts with some international rivals who are scaling back operations ⁣due to concerns⁣ about Hong Kong’s economic outlook and the challenges facing⁢ its property market.

Contrasting Trends in Hong Kong’s Financial Sector

While some international banks⁢ are reassessing their Hong Kong operations due to ⁣a⁣ combination of economic slowdown and political uncertainty, Taiwanese ⁤lenders appear to be viewing the situation differently. The property market,a key driver of Hong Kong’s economy,has faced important⁤ challenges in recent years,contributing⁤ to the cautious approach of some financial institutions. However, Taiwanese banks are actively seeking to fill the⁤ gaps left by those who⁢ are retrenching.

Strategic Positioning and Opportunities

The expansion of ⁤Taiwanese ⁢lenders ⁣may be driven by several factors. Hong Kong remains ⁢a crucial financial hub for Taiwanese businesses and individuals seeking international investment opportunities. Increased geopolitical tensions could also be prompting a need for financial institutions with strong ties to Taiwan to provide services and support in the‍ region.
